Output 550659ddc8e59d21db20841ea364547037476166a8171ad327bff191e8086724:30

value
586102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f766391468b2c9d05cacbdcedfd024b2d25fea1 OP_EQUAL
address
3APmwaJrPr1bm4aD6hcktjrJngpN3oVuwy
transaction
550659ddc8e59d21db20841ea364547037476166a8171ad327bff191e8086724
spent
true